[Ur] Five weird questions involving kind `Name` vs type `string`

I'm curious about differences (and possible relationships or conversions?)
between:
- things of kind `Name`
- things type `string`
I'm fairly certain the answers to questions (1) and (2) and (3) below are
all "No".
The answers to questions (4) and (5) are probably also "No" - but maybe
not...
----------
Questions:
(1) Given a string such as:
"Field1"
is there any way to refer to the corresponding Name, ie:
#Field1
?
---------
(2) Is it possible for a function to have a signature like:
val makeName str : string -> [ nm :: Name ]
In other words, is it possible for a function to *return* something of kind
`Name`?
---------
(3)(a) Is there some syntax like the following in Ur/Web:
val myFieldName = "Field1"
#{myFieldName}
?
---------
(3)(b) Is there some syntax like the following in Ur/Web:
#{"Field1"}
?
---------
(4) The following function occurs in files crud.urs / crud.ur of the Crud1,
Crud2, Crud3 demos:
*.urs
val checkboxWidget_n : nm :: Name -> xml form [] [nm = widget]
*.ur
val checkboxWidget_n = [nm :: Name] => <xml><checkbox{nm}/></xml>
Would some syntax like the following be possible (using type `string`
instead of kind `Name`):
*.urs
val checkboxWidget_s : str : string -> xml form [] [#{str} = widget]
*.ur
val checkboxWidget_s = str : string => <xml><checkbox{str}/></xml>
?
---------
(5) Can something of type `string` (instead of something of kind `Name`) be
used in the __ positions in examples (a) or (b) shown below:
(a)
<xml><checkbox{__}/></xml>
(b)
<xml>
<select{__}>
<option>"New York"</option>
<option>"London"</option>
<option>"Paris"</option>
</select>
</xml>
?
---------
